Valkey Operator

A Kubernetes operator for deploying and managing production-grade Valkey instances — standalone or highly available with Sentinel.

Go Kubernetes License

Features

  • Standalone & HA modes — single-node or multi-node with automatic Sentinel deployment
  • TLS encryption — full TLS for Valkey, replication, and Sentinel via cert-manager or user-provided Secrets
  • Persistence — RDB, AOF, or both with configurable PVCs
  • Authentication — password from Kubernetes Secret
  • Observability — CRD status visible in kubectl and Lens, Kubernetes Events
  • Controlled rolling updates — replica-first rollout with replication sync verification and automatic failover
  • Network policies — optional firewall rules for Valkey and Sentinel traffic
  • Helm deployment — install the operator with a single helm install

HA — 3 Replicas with Sentinel

A production-ready HA setup: 3 Valkey nodes (1 master + 2 replicas) with 3 Sentinel instances for automatic failover.

apiVersion: vko.gtrfc.com/v1
kind: Valkey
metadata:
  name: ha-cluster
spec:
  replicas: 3
  image: valkey/valkey:8.0
  sentinel:
    enabled: true
    replicas: 3
  persistence:
    enabled: true
    mode: rdb
    size: 10Gi
  resources:
    requests:
      cpu: 250m
      memory: 256Mi
    limits:
      cpu: "1"
      memory: 1Gi

The operator creates:

Resource Name Count
StatefulSet ha-cluster 3 Valkey pods
StatefulSet ha-cluster-sentinel 3 Sentinel pods
ConfigMap ha-cluster-config Master config
ConfigMap ha-cluster-replica-config Replica config (with replicaof)
ConfigMap ha-cluster-sentinel-config Sentinel config
Service ha-cluster Client-facing (ClusterIP)
Service ha-cluster-headless Valkey DNS (headless)
Service ha-cluster-sentinel-headless Sentinel DNS (headless)

CRD Reference

spec
Field Type Default Description
replicas int32 1 Number of Valkey instances
image string (required) Valkey container image (e.g., valkey/valkey:8.0)
sentinel SentinelSpec Sentinel HA configuration
auth AuthSpec Authentication configuration
tls TLSSpec TLS encryption configuration
metrics MetricsSpec Metrics exporter configuration
networkPolicy NetworkPolicySpec NetworkPolicy configuration
persistence PersistenceSpec Data persistence configuration
podLabels map[string]string Additional labels for Valkey pods
podAnnotations map[string]string Additional annotations for Valkey pods
resources ResourceRequirements CPU/memory requests and limits
spec.sentinel
Field Type Default Description
enabled bool false Enable Sentinel HA mode
replicas int32 3 Number of Sentinel instances
podLabels map[string]string Additional labels for Sentinel pods
podAnnotations map[string]string Additional annotations for Sentinel pods
spec.tls
Field Type Default Description
enabled bool false Enable TLS encryption
certManager CertManagerSpec cert-manager integration (mutually exclusive with secretName)
secretName string Name of existing TLS Secret (must contain tls.crt, tls.key, ca.crt)
spec.tls.certManager
Field Type Description
issuer.kind string Issuer or ClusterIssuer
issuer.name string Name of the issuer resource
issuer.group string API group (default: cert-manager.io)
extraDnsNames []string Additional DNS names for the certificate
spec.persistence
Field Type Default Description
enabled bool false Enable persistent storage
mode string rdb Persistence mode: rdb, aof, or both
storageClass string "" StorageClass name (empty = default)
size Quantity 1Gi Requested storage size
spec.auth
Field Type Default Description
secretName string Kubernetes Secret name containing the password
secretPasswordKey string password Key within the Secret
status
Field Type Description
readyReplicas int32 Number of ready Valkey instances
masterPod string Name of the current master pod
phase string Current lifecycle phase
message string Human-readable status description
conditions []Condition Standard Kubernetes conditions
Phase Values
Phase Description
OK Cluster is healthy
Provisioning Initial setup in progress
Syncing Replication sync in progress
Rolling Update X/Y Rolling update progress
Failover in progress Sentinel-triggered leader switch
Error Error state (see message for details)

Common Labels

All managed resources carry a consistent set of labels:

app.kubernetes.io/component: valkey | sentinel
app.kubernetes.io/instance: <cr-name>
app.kubernetes.io/managed-by: vko.gtrfc.com
app.kubernetes.io/name: valkey
app.kubernetes.io/version: <image-tag>
vko.gtrfc.com/cluster: <cr-name>

Pod-level labels additionally include:

vko.gtrfc.com/instanceName: <pod-name>
vko.gtrfc.com/instanceRole: master | replica

TLS Details

When TLS is enabled (spec.tls.enabled: true):

  • The plaintext port 6379 is disabled (port 0)
  • Valkey listens on TLS port 16379
  • Sentinel listens on TLS port 26379
  • All replication traffic is encrypted (tls-replication yes)
  • Probes use valkey-cli --tls with the mounted certificates

Connecting to a TLS-enabled instance from within the cluster:

valkey-cli --tls \
  --cert /tls/tls.crt \
  --key /tls/tls.key \
  --cacert /tls/ca.crt \
  -h my-valkey -p 16379 PING

Persistence Modes

Mode Description
rdb Point-in-time snapshots (save 900 1, save 300 10, save 60 10000)
aof Append-only file with appendfsync everysec
both RDB + AOF combined for maximum durability
